高性价比
国外便宜VPS服务器推荐

Java主函数如何实现分布式缓存的同步

在Java开发中,主方法作为程序的入口点,通常用于启动应用程序。然而,在分布式系统中,如何实现缓存同步成为了一个关键问题。随着微服务架构的普及,多个节点之间的数据一致性变得尤为重要。为了确保各个实例能够共享最新的缓存数据,需要采用高效的分布式缓存同步机制。

1. 分布式缓存同步的重要性

在分布式环境中,每个服务实例可能运行在不同的服务器上,它们各自维护本地缓存。如果这些缓存没有及时同步,可能导致数据不一致,影响系统的稳定性和用户体验。因此,实现缓存同步是保障系统可靠性的基础。

通过分布式缓存同步,可以确保所有节点访问到相同的数据版本,避免因数据延迟或丢失导致的问题。这不仅提升了系统的性能,也增强了整体的可扩展性。

2. 产品优势:高效稳定的缓存同步方案

针对Java应用的分布式缓存同步需求,我们提供了一套高效稳定的解决方案。该方案基于主流的缓存技术,如Redis、Ehcache等,结合Java语言特性,实现了低延迟、高可靠的数据同步机制。

我们的产品支持多种缓存策略,包括读写分离、过期策略、数据分区等,能够灵活适配不同业务场景。同时,内置的监控模块可以实时跟踪缓存状态,帮助用户快速定位和解决问题。

此外,该方案还具备良好的兼容性,能够与常见的Java框架如Spring Boot、MyBatis无缝集成,降低开发和部署成本。

3. 应用场景:多节点环境下的缓存管理

分布式缓存同步广泛应用于电商、金融、物流等多个行业。例如,在电商平台中,商品信息、库存数据等需要在多个服务器之间保持一致,以确保用户下单时不会出现超卖或缺货的情况。

在金融系统中,交易数据的实时同步至关重要。任何数据延迟都可能导致交易失败或资金损失。通过我们的缓存同步方案,可以确保所有节点获取到最新数据,提升交易成功率。

在物流系统中,订单状态、运输信息等也需要在多个节点之间同步。借助高效的缓存机制,可以显著提高系统响应速度,优化用户体验。

4. 服务特色:专业团队与定制化支持

我们拥有一支专业的技术团队,具备丰富的分布式系统开发经验。无论是缓存架构设计、性能调优,还是故障排查,我们都能够提供全方位的支持。

根据客户的实际需求,我们可以提供定制化的缓存同步方案。从初期规划到后期运维,全程跟进,确保项目顺利落地。

此外,我们还提供7×24小时的技术支持服务,随时响应客户反馈,解决使用过程中遇到的问题,保障系统的稳定运行。

5. 实现方式:Java主方法中的缓存同步逻辑

在Java主方法中实现缓存同步,通常需要结合缓存中间件和消息队列。例如,当某个节点更新了缓存数据,可以通过消息队列通知其他节点进行更新。

具体实现步骤包括:初始化缓存客户端、配置同步策略、编写数据更新逻辑、处理异常情况等。在整个过程中,需要确保同步操作的原子性和一致性,防止数据冲突。

同时,还可以利用AOP面向切面编程技术,对缓存操作进行统一管理,提高代码的可维护性和扩展性。

6. 提升SEO表现的关键词覆盖

为了提升文章的搜索引擎优化效果,我们在内容中合理嵌入了相关关键词,如“分布式缓存同步”、“Java主方法”、“缓存同步方案”、“Java缓存管理”等。这些关键词不仅有助于提高文章的搜索排名,也能帮助读者更精准地找到所需信息。

同时,我们避免了重复用词,保持内容的专业性和多样性。通过结构清晰的段落和小标题,使文章更具可读性,进一步增强SEO表现。

7. 结论:打造高效稳定的缓存同步系统

在现代Java应用中,分布式缓存同步是一项不可或缺的技术。它不仅提高了系统的性能和可靠性,还为后续的扩展和维护提供了便利。

通过我们的解决方案,开发者可以轻松实现缓存同步,减少开发复杂度,提升系统稳定性。无论您是初学者还是资深工程师,都能从中受益。

如果您对分布式缓存同步感兴趣,欢迎咨询我们的技术团队,了解更多详细信息。我们提供免费试用和一对一技术支持,助您快速上手,提升系统效率。

未经允许不得转载:一万网络 » Java主函数如何实现分布式缓存的同步